Abstract
The invention discloses application of an apple tree branch extract in the preparation of hypoglycemic drugs or foods. As shown by experimental results, the apple tree branch extract can obviously lower the blood sugar value of a mouse suffering from streptozotocin-induced type 1 diabetes and can obviously increase the tolerance dose of the mouse suffering from the streptozotocin-induced type 1 diabetes to glucose, sucrose and starch.

Background technology
The apple branch extract is the extract that the aquiferous ethanol take apple branch as prepared using water or variable concentrations obtains as solvent extraction.The chemical constituent of apple branch extract and pharmacological effect research are less, determine at present to comprise triterpenes and multiple aldehydes matter
[1], wherein polyphenol components is take flavonoid and methods of glycosides thereof as main.The apple branch extract has the effects such as stronger antioxidation, arteriosclerosis
[1]At present, the report of the hypoglycemic activity relevant with Fructus Mali pumilae has the apple polyphenol hypoglycemic activity
[2], the hypoglycemic activity of high-purity phlorizin in the apple branch extract
[3-4], and the hypoglycemic activity of apple branch extract so far there are no the report.
Summary of the invention
The object of the present invention is to provide the application of apple branch extract in preparation hypoglycemic drug or blood sugar reducing food.
Technical scheme of the present invention is summarized as follows:
The application of apple branch extract in preparation hypoglycemic drug or blood sugar reducing food.
Described apple branch extract is to make with following method: be that the ethanol water of 10%-99.9% carries out reflux, extract, with the apple branch of 1 mass fraction with the volumetric concentration of the water of 3-12 mass fraction or 3-12 mass fraction, extract 1-4 time, the each extraction 1-5 hour, filter, filtrate decompression is concentrated, getting pol is the concentrate of 20-40, and drying obtains the apple branch extract.
The kind of described Fructus Mali pumilae be Fuji, state's light, Qiao Najin, Pink Lady, Qin Yang, Qin Guan, loud, high-pitched sound, No. 8, Granny Smith, carbuncle, Red Star, Colophonium any of several broadleaf plants or the U.S..
The dosage form of described hypoglycemic drug is hard capsule, soft capsule, powder, granule, tablet, pill, sweet unguentum, oral liquid, medicated wine, injection or medicinal tea.
Described blood sugar reducing food is beverage, confection, rice food, flour product, meat products, fish product or edible oil.
The results show: the apple branch extract can obviously reduce the blood glucose value of the type 1 diabetes mice that streptozotocin induces.Can obviously improve type 1 diabetes mice that streptozotocin induces to glucose, sucrose and starch dosis tolerata.

We study and find that different cultivars apple branch extract component composition is similar, and the content of each main component can be slightly variant.The bibliographical information apple polyphenol mainly contains chlorogenic acid, procyanidin class and flavones ingredient
[1]In order to determine the composition difference of apple polyphenol extract and apple branch extract, the liquid chromatogram of we the have utilized high-performance liquid chromatogram determination apple branch extract of same concentrations (weight/volume) (embodiment of the invention 1 preparation) and apple polyphenol (being purchased from Jianfeng Natural Product R﹠D Development Co., Ltd., Tianjin), and its one-tenth is grouped into analyzes test result such as Fig. 1 and 2.Can obviously determine relatively that by Fig. 1, Fig. 2 the apple branch extract is becoming to be grouped into to exist notable difference with apple polyphenol, and have no chlorogenic acid and procyanidin constituents composition in the apple branch extract.Therefore the apple branch extract has hypoglycemic purposes, and it brings into play pharmaceutically-active material base is different from apple polyphenol.
The hypoglycemic activity of the type 1 diabetes mice that embodiment 16 apple branch extracts are induced streptozotocin
Get the type 1 diabetes ICR mice that the streptozotocin about body weight 40g is induced
[5], random packet, 10 every group, be divided into model control group and apple branch extract administration group (being respectively embodiment 1-embodiment 14 preparations), apple branch extract administration group gavage gives apple branch extract 1.5g/kg; Model control group gives isopyknic water.In 0,2h gets blood, measures blood glucose with glucose assays test kit (Zhongsheng Beikong Biological Science ﹠ Technology Co., Ltd.), calculating mean value, t check analysis result, the administration group relatively has significant difference with blank group.The result is as shown in table 1.Each administration group of apple branch extract can both obviously reduce the blood glucose value of the type 1 diabetes mice that streptozotocin induces at administration 2h.

The impact of the Glucose tolerance test of the type 1 diabetes mice that embodiment 17 apple branch extracts are induced streptozotocin
Get the type 1 diabetes ICR mice that the streptozotocin about body weight 40g is induced
[1], random packet, 10 every group, be divided into model control group and apple branch extract administration group (being respectively embodiment 1-embodiment 14 preparations), apple branch extract administration group gavage gives apple branch extract 1.5g/kg; Model control group gives isopyknic water.Successive administration is after 1 week, animal overnight fasting, 30min after the administration 1 time, then gavage glucose (2g/kg), in administration 0,1,2h gets blood, measures blood glucose with glucose assays test kit (Zhongsheng Beikong Biological Science ﹠ Technology Co., Ltd.), calculating mean value carries out the t check analysis.The results are shown in Table 2.Experimental result shows the apple branch extract after one week of administration, and the Glucose tolerance test tool of the type 1 diabetes mice that streptozotocin is induced is significantly improved.

The impact of the sucrose dosis tolerata of the type 1 diabetes mice that embodiment 18 apple branch extracts are induced streptozotocin
Get the type 1 diabetes ICR mice that the streptozotocin about body weight 40g is induced
[1], random packet, 10 every group, be divided into model control group and apple branch extract administration group (being respectively embodiment 1-embodiment 14 preparations), apple branch extract administration group gavage gives apple branch extract 1.5g/kg; Model control group gives isopyknic water.Successive administration is after 1 week, animal overnight fasting, 30min after the administration 1 time, then gavage sucrose (2g/kg), in administration 0,1,2h gets blood, measures blood glucose with glucose assays test kit (Zhongsheng Beikong Biological Science ﹠ Technology Co., Ltd.), calculating mean value carries out the t check analysis.The results are shown in Table 3.Experimental result shows the apple branch extract after one week of administration, and the sucrose dosis tolerata tool of the type 1 diabetes mice that streptozotocin is induced is significantly improved.

The impact of the starch dosis tolerata of the type 1 diabetes mice that embodiment 19 apple branch extracts are induced streptozotocin
Get the type 1 diabetes ICR mice that the streptozotocin about body weight 40g is induced, random packet, every group 10, be divided into model control group and apple branch extract administration group (being respectively embodiment 1-embodiment 14 preparations), apple branch extract administration group gavage gives apple branch extract 1.5g/kg; Model control group gives isopyknic water.Successive administration is after 1 week, animal overnight fasting, 30min after the administration 1 time, then gavage starch (2g/kg), in administration 0,40min, 130min get blood, measures blood glucose with glucose assays test kit (Zhongsheng Beikong Biological Science ﹠ Technology Co., Ltd.), calculating mean value carries out the t check analysis.The results are shown in Table 4.Experimental result shows the apple branch extract after one week of administration, and the starch dosis tolerata tool of the type 1 diabetes mice that streptozotocin is induced is significantly improved.

The effect of lowering blood sugar of embodiment 20 apple branch extracts and phlorhizin relatively
After measured, contain phlorhizin (seeing that the peak that is positioned at the 62min place among Fig. 1 is phlorhizin) in the apple branch extract.Regulate in early days the effect report of blood glucose relevant for phlorhizin.Phlorhizin is natural glucose-sodium cotransporter inhibitor, orally affects its absorption and plays a role.The type 1 diabetes mouse model that we utilize streptozotocin to induce, divide three groups, every group of 10 mices, orally respectively give apple branch extract and normal saline (model control group) that phlorhizin and embodiment 8 obtain and test, phlorhizin gives the amount of contained phlorhizin in the apple branch extract that dosage is equal to embodiment 8 preparations.(having measured the apple branch extract phlorhizin content that embodiment 8 obtains according to the detection method of embodiment 15 is 19.6%.According to the test method of embodiment 16 and the dosage of apple branch extract, the dosage of converting out the phlorhizin sterling is that gavage gives 0.3g/kg phlorhizin (content is 98%), tests according to 16 lower methods of embodiment.Experimental result is as shown in table 6, gives sample after 7 days, and 0 o'clock blood glucose of embodiment 8 administration groups (1.5g/kg) groups has downward trend, again give apple branch extract 2h after, blood glucose descends obviously.The phlorhizin effect then relatively a little less than.The result shows: the effect of apple branch extract oral adjusting blood glucose is not the effect from phlorhizin, but other functional component is playing a role in the apple polyphenol.
